Not quite a millionaire...

Andrew Kempley-Smith's questions on Who Wants to be a Millionaire.

How would you have fared?

£100
Which of these is the title of a 1946 film starring Humphrey Bogart and Lauren Bacall?

A: The Big Sleep, B: The Big Doze, C: The Big Nap, D: The Big Kip

Correct Answer: A, Given Answer: A.

£200
Traditionally, what is put in a hanging basket?

A: Washing, B: Bread, C: Plants, D: Babies

Correct Answer: C, Given Answer: C.

£300
What name is given to the small area of an office where one person works?

A: Work garage, B: Work airport, C: Work station, D: Work car park

Correct Answer: C, Given Answer: C.

£500
What is heated to make caramel?

A: Egg, B: Flour, C: Salt, D: Sugar

Correct Answer: D, Given Answer: D.

£1,000
Complete the title of the 1963 Neil Simon play: 'Barefoot in the...'?

A: Garden, B: Zoo, C: Park, D: Snow

Correct Answer: C, Given Answer: C.

£2,000
In pre-decimal currency, which coin was worth two shillings and sixpence?

A: Farthing, B: Half-crown, C: Guinea, D: Florin

Correct Answer: B, Given Answer: B.

£4,000
Anything described as 'gustatory' refers to which of the senses?

A: Touch, B: Sight, C: Smell, D: Taste

Contestant uses 50-50 Lifeline, Answers AC were removed.

Correct Answer: D, Given Answer: D.

£8,000
What was the first name of Winston Churchill's wife?

A: Clementine, B: Gwendoline, C: Adeline, D: Rosaline

Contestant uses ATA Lifeline, Vote result: A(68%), B(18%), C(6%), D(8%).

Correct Answer: A, Given Answer: A.

£16,000
A standard game of ten-pin bowling is comprised of ten...what?

A: Frames, B: Sets, C: Legs, D: Rounds

Contestant uses PAF Lifeline.

Correct Answer: A, Given Answer: A.

£32,000
'Night and Day' is a 1946 film about which famous songwriter?

A: Irving Berlin, B: Leonard Bernstein, C: Cole Porter, D: Richard Rodgers

Correct Answer: C, Given Answer: Pass.

Contestant has passed (Guess: C)

ANDREW KEMPLEY-SMITH Winnings: £16,000
